I am using unstack for a table in MATLAB, in the new table it converts variable names to matlab readable format i.e. replaces period( . ) wth underscore ( _ ), I tried a lot looking over for alternatives for eg use 'VariableNamingRule' as 'preserve' but that doesn't work giving me error 'VariableNamingRule is not a valid parameter for unstack', I took this from official website https://www.mathworks.com/help/matlab/ref/unstack.html but nothing seems to help.

That Name-Value pair was not introduced until R2020a. You appear to be using R2019b. You can see your release-specific documentation page here:
You will need to update to at least 20a if you want to use this setting. There is no workaround for 19b.
